> Currently normalizePath() is used in several places allowing users to specify 
> paths via the use of tilde expansion, or to normalize a relative path to an 
> absolute path. However, normalizePath() is used for paths which are actually 
> expected to be a URI. normalizePath() may display warning messages when it 
> does not recognize a URI as a local file path. So suppressWarnings() is used 
> to suppress the possible warnings.
> Worse than warnings, call normalizePath() on a URI may cause error. Because 
> it may turn a user specified relative path to an absolute path using the 
> local current directory, but this may not be true because the path is 
> actually relative to the working directory of the default file system instead 
> of the local file system (depends on the Hadoop configuration of Spark).
